What is the Hong Kong Building Works Appointment Notice?

The Hong Kong Building Works Appointment Notice, also known as Form BA 4, is a crucial document for appointing professionals involved in building or street works in Hong Kong. This form is designed to ensure that projects comply with local building regulations, facilitating the responsible execution of various construction activities.
To ensure proper accountability, the form requires signatures from key professionals: the Authorized Person, Registered Structural Engineer, and Registered Geotechnical Engineer. Each role plays a critical part in the overall building process, ensuring that safety and regulatory measures are adhered to effectively.
